Safety

There are many different options for microwaves such as freestanding models that double as traditional ovens and grills, and built-in versions that fit into an existing cabinet or niche. When deciding on the right microwave for your kitchen, you should consider aspects like capacity, preprogrammed settings, and other features.

Always adhere to the guidelines provided by the manufacturer for the microwave you have purchased. Make sure you have enough space around your microwave to allow air circulation, and to avoid overheating. In addition, ensure you only use microwave-safe containers and do not place any metal objects inside the microwave. They will emit electromagnetic radiation and trigger electric shocks, which could be dangerous.

Although the radiation from a microwave does heat the body's tissues, it does not cause cancer. The type of radiation that is generated by microwaves is referred to as non-ionizing. It is distinct from ionizing radiation such as x-rays or high-energy particles, which can cause damage to the human body. Furthermore, long-term rodent studies have not proved that low levels of microwave radiation are carcinogenic.

However, microwave radiation can cause burns if you're close to the food as it is heating. It can also cause steam explosions in liquids if the container is too big and you're microwave-ing something that's boiling. This can be dangerous because the liquid may explode out of the container and burn you. To avoid this, microwave liquids and food in containers that are microwave-safe or made of materials like glass, ceramic or polypropylene.

Additionally, it is important to stir or rotate foods halfway through the cooking process to ensure even heating. This can reduce the chance of hot and cool spots which could lead to food poisoning. You should also be careful when heating baby formula or other foods for children who are small in a microwave. They may absorb radiation differently than adults, and this could result in overheating. In addition, you should keep an ice cube nearby to pour over overheated drinks and foods in order to prevent scalding accidents.
